First off, if you thought this was an ad for some Daihatsu Samurai Nordstrom's mall crawler, close this page. You're not ready.

This is three thousand pounds of American Muscle Steak and Eggs. Forged in the fiery hell of Detroit Michigan, from the same steel as Captain America's shield and Superman's cape, this truck chews tobacco and spits molten sex appeal. About every third Saturday, I find two smart cars and a Toyota Prius wedged up in the wheel wells. The interior is 100% Kodiak Bearskin and NASA-approved rocket chair.

The Air Conditioning is in excellent order, but really...if you're hot, it's because the massive 8 cylinder thunderstorm under the hood is spewing Clydesdale horses as you try to outrun the Victoria's Secret Angels that are in hot pursuit. Just take off the rear cab, and flex those guns, under the California sunshine, while your American bald eagle rides shotgun.

The 31" (31-10.5X15) Michelin LTX AT2 tires might as well be sharpened Puma claws, the way they cut into the asphalt, like C Thomas Howell into a new deer, ala "Red Dawn." With less than 10k miles, they still have whiskers, and so will you, just by climbing into this beast.

The interior smells like Neal Armstrong, Magnum P.I. and Rocky Balboa. Immaculately maintained, and always garaged, so the clamoring hordes wouldn't cover it in drool and fingerprints, there isn't a blemish, dent, rust, or hidden flaw on this beauty. Does Batman park the Batmobile outside? Did Pepe keep his Little Mule parked in the yard, in "Romancing the Stone"? Neither do I.

Those roof racks? Seal Team Six approved for loading Zodiac boats and 50cal ammo cans. On the back, there's a 2" receiver for pulling the nose off the Sphynx or launching Sonny Crockett's cigarette boat, as "Smuggler's Blues" blasts out of the stereo.

If you have any questions, call or text, and I'll try to get back to you as soon as possible, with a call or additional specific pictures from my phone. If you're nearby, come take a look, a test drive, then make me an offer.

I purchased this truck from the original owner in '94 when it was only 5 years old, and it's been my pride and joy ever since. Be sure, everything works, and has been routinely serviced and cared for.You won't be disappointed, this car looks even better in person.

And get ready to buy a cape, hero.
